testing: remaining tests #16

Merged
squel merged 2 commits from squel/remaining-tests into main 2025-03-13 21:35:04 +00:00 AGit
Owner

As described at squel/steam-manifest#8

As described at squel/steam-manifest#8
Author
Owner

documenting tests...

documenting tests... - https://git.squel.xyz/squel/steam-manifest/src/commit/344060e8f5a42d1727095926c4c6a56b5abc3c6d/decoder/tests/ExpectedFailure/ManifestEncrypted/depot_440_1118032470228587934.manifest - via https://github.com/SteamRE/SteamKit/blob/master/SteamKit2/Tests/Files/depot_440_1118032470228587934.manifest - should trigger https://git.squel.xyz/squel/steam-manifest/src/commit/344060e8f5a42d1727095926c4c6a56b5abc3c6d/decoder/decoder.go#L108-L113 - https://git.squel.xyz/squel/steam-manifest/src/commit/82e9c943a112c5a959e924b1b951604db0e1081c/decoder/tests/ExpectedFailure/EntryFilenameHashIncorrect/depot_440_1118032470228587934_decrypted.manifest - via https://github.com/SteamRE/SteamKit/blob/master/SteamKit2/Tests/Files/depot_440_1118032470228587934_decrypted.manifest - modified offsets 0x25-0x38 zeroed - should trigger https://git.squel.xyz/squel/steam-manifest/src/commit/82e9c943a112c5a959e924b1b951604db0e1081c/decoder/decoder.go#L156-L162 - https://git.squel.xyz/squel/steam-manifest/src/commit/344060e8f5a42d1727095926c4c6a56b5abc3c6d/decoder/tests/ExpectedFailure/ManifestHeaderIncorrect/depot_440_1118032470228587934_decrypted_end-of-manifest.manifest - via https://github.com/SteamRE/SteamKit/blob/master/SteamKit2/Tests/Files/depot_440_1118032470228587934_decrypted.manifest - modified offsets 0x349-0x34C set to `F1AC`/`66 31 61 63` - should trigger https://git.squel.xyz/squel/steam-manifest/src/commit/82e9c943a112c5a959e924b1b951604db0e1081c/decoder/decoder.go#L113-L126 - https://git.squel.xyz/squel/steam-manifest/src/commit/344060e8f5a42d1727095926c4c6a56b5abc3c6d/decoder/tests/ExpectedFailure/ManifestHeaderIncorrect/depot_440_1118032470228587934_decrypted_metadata.manifest - via https://github.com/SteamRE/SteamKit/blob/master/SteamKit2/Tests/Files/depot_440_1118032470228587934_decrypted.manifest - modified offsets 0x30E-0x311 set to `FACE/46 41 43 45` - should trigger https://git.squel.xyz/squel/steam-manifest/src/commit/82e9c943a112c5a959e924b1b951604db0e1081c/decoder/decoder.go#L60-L73 - https://git.squel.xyz/squel/steam-manifest/src/commit/344060e8f5a42d1727095926c4c6a56b5abc3c6d/decoder/tests/ExpectedFailure/ManifestHeaderIncorrect/depot_440_1118032470228587934_decrypted_payload.manifest - via https://github.com/SteamRE/SteamKit/blob/master/SteamKit2/Tests/Files/depot_440_1118032470228587934_decrypted.manifest - modified offsets 0x0-0x3 set to `f00d/66 30 30 64` - should trigger https://git.squel.xyz/squel/steam-manifest/src/commit/82e9c943a112c5a959e924b1b951604db0e1081c/decoder/decoder.go#L29-L42 - https://git.squel.xyz/squel/steam-manifest/src/commit/344060e8f5a42d1727095926c4c6a56b5abc3c6d/decoder/tests/ExpectedFailure/ManifestHeaderIncorrect/depot_440_1118032470228587934_decrypted_signature.manifest - via https://github.com/SteamRE/SteamKit/blob/master/SteamKit2/Tests/Files/depot_440_1118032470228587934_decrypted.manifest - modified offsets 0x341-0x348 set to `DEADBEEF/44 45 41 44 42 45 45 46` - should trigger https://git.squel.xyz/squel/steam-manifest/src/commit/82e9c943a112c5a959e924b1b951604db0e1081c/decoder/decoder.go#L98-L111
squel changed title from drop debug to testing: remaining tests 2025-02-13 11:25:45 +00:00
squel force-pushed squel/remaining-tests from 82e9c943a1 to ada7096d54
All checks were successful
/ test (pull_request) Successful in 47s
2025-02-15 19:26:14 +00:00
Compare
squel merged commit 4250d96fd9 into main 2025-03-13 21:35:04 +00:00
Sign in to join this conversation.
No reviewers
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
squel/steam-manifest!16
No description provided.